Output 40e6621bbe997e9d7f1dfff6e53f6fc167705f78e7740fb1d6ea21b265ceac63:2

value
60564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ef561e46992629c335ef74cd6b4da6b37608854 OP_EQUAL
address
3EiuqFX5AbPNtU4swTENN1kMSPQkBJxej7
transaction
40e6621bbe997e9d7f1dfff6e53f6fc167705f78e7740fb1d6ea21b265ceac63
spent
true